WebApr 7, 2024 · While not caffeine-free like “Mugicha” barley tea (which, by definition, is not really “tea” at all), Hojicha is definitely low in caffeine. Although many factors affect the caffeine content, including the age of the leaves used and the ratio of stems used, a good rule of thumb is that it has approximately a tenth of the amount of ... WebL-theanine is a slightly calming amino acid which is present in green tea, and known to be synergistic with caffeine, also present in tea. It can be found as a supplement and taken with coffee to reduce caffeine jitters. …

WebNov 4, 2014 · However, drinking too much green tea (more than 5 cups a day) is considered to be unsafe. When consumed in excess, green tea side effects include stomach problems, heartburn, diarrhea, headache, palpitation and arrhythmia, anemia, tremors and muscle contractions, diabetes, glaucoma, high blood pressure, and osteoporosis.
